A Female Cat Spayed, A Male With Swollen Face Treated For Ear Mites 6th Sep 2011, by AnimalCare
Mrs Lim operates a launderette in USJ and she also looks after the neighbourhood cats and dogs. She sent one more female cat to be spayed under our sponsorship today.The female catMrs Lim also found a male cat who had been crouching at the alley for some time. The cat was brought in as well, and the vet said he had ear mites.The infection is so bad that his whole face is swollen and he cannot even open his eyes (see photos below). Support From The Penang State Veterinary Department 6th Sep 2011, by MDDB & MCCP Penang
The Penang Veterinary Department has agreed to give us their full support in our spaying program for the stray animals in Penang. MPSP has also came by our halfway home today to conduct an interview and has verbally given us their support. We thank both the departments for their co-operation and quick response. Updates On 6th Sep 2011 6th Sep 2011, by SPCA Sarawak
Foster families are always welcome. You get the best of both worlds. You get a pet in your home which you can always return if it's adopted or if you feel you REALLY cannot handle one. And of course you'll be doing the animal a whole lot of good by caring for it in a home environment so that it'll be used to human contact.

Updates On Imm's Shelter In Ipoh (and Thank You!) 6th Sep 2011, by AnimalCare
Imm's Shelter is an animal sanctuary run by 60+ year-old lady, Oei Phaik Imm, who was in dire straits some six months back. At that time, she was depressed, in very poor health and finances were running low, and was hence, on the verge of giving up on her sanctuary.
